什么时db数据库

不及物动词 其他 39

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    DB数据库是指数据库(Database)的简称,它是计算机系统中用于存储、管理和检索大量数据的软件系统。数据库是构建在硬盘等物理存储介质上的,它具有高效的数据组织、存储和管理能力,可以提供数据的持久化存储,并支持对数据的快速访问和查询。

    数据库的使用广泛应用于各个领域,例如企业管理、电子商务、社交媒体、科学研究等。它能够存储和管理大量的数据,并提供高效的数据检索和处理功能,为用户提供了方便快捷的数据管理和分析工具。

    数据库的种类有很多,常见的有关系型数据库(如MySQL、Oracle、SQL Server)、非关系型数据库(如MongoDB、Redis)等。不同类型的数据库在数据存储方式、数据操作语言和数据一致性等方面有所差异,用户可以根据具体的需求选择适合的数据库类型。

    数据库具有以下特点:

    1. 数据的持久化存储:数据库将数据存储在硬盘等物理介质上,可以长期保存数据,即使系统重启或断电也不会丢失。
    2. 高效的数据检索:数据库采用索引等技术,可以快速定位和检索数据,提高数据的查询效率。
    3. 数据的安全性和完整性:数据库可以设置访问权限和数据约束,保证数据的安全性和完整性。
    4. 支持并发操作:数据库支持多个用户同时对数据进行读写操作,提供了并发控制机制,保证数据的一致性和完整性。
    5. 可扩展性:数据库可以根据需求进行扩展,支持存储大量的数据,并提供高并发的访问能力。

    总而言之,DB数据库是一种用于存储、管理和检索大量数据的软件系统,它具有高效的数据存储和处理能力,广泛应用于各个领域。通过使用数据库,用户可以方便地管理和分析数据,提高工作效率和决策能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    DB数据库是指数据库(Database)的缩写,是一种用于存储、管理和检索数据的系统。它是计算机应用中最常用的数据存储方式之一,被广泛应用于各种领域,包括企业管理、科学研究、社交网络、电子商务等。以下是关于DB数据库的一些重要内容:

    1. 数据模型:DB数据库采用不同的数据模型来组织和管理数据。常见的数据模型包括关系型数据库(如MySQL、Oracle)、面向对象数据库(如MongoDB)和图数据库(如Neo4j)。每种数据模型都有其适用的场景和特点,可以根据具体需求选择合适的数据库类型。

    2. 数据结构:DB数据库使用不同的数据结构来组织数据。关系型数据库使用表(Table)来表示数据,表由行(Row)和列(Column)组成;面向对象数据库使用对象(Object)来表示数据,对象可以包含属性(Attribute)和方法(Method);图数据库使用节点(Node)和边(Edge)来表示数据,节点和边可以具有不同的属性。不同的数据结构决定了数据库的存储和查询方式。

    3. 数据操作:DB数据库提供了一系列操作数据的方法和语言。常见的数据操作语言包括结构化查询语言(SQL)、JavaScript Object Notation(JSON)和Cypher等。通过这些语言,可以对数据库进行增删改查操作,并进行复杂的数据操作,如聚合、连接和排序等。

    4. 数据一致性:DB数据库通过事务(Transaction)来保证数据的一致性。事务是一组数据库操作的集合,要么全部成功执行,要么全部回滚。在并发访问和多用户场景下,事务可以防止数据的丢失、冲突和不一致。

    5. 数据安全性:DB数据库提供了多种安全机制来保护数据的安全性。这包括用户认证、访问控制、数据加密、备份和恢复等。通过这些安全措施,可以防止数据被未授权的访问、篡改或丢失。

    总之,DB数据库是一种用于存储、管理和检索数据的系统,它使用不同的数据模型、数据结构和数据操作语言来组织和操作数据。通过事务和安全机制,它可以保证数据的一致性和安全性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    DB数据库指的是数据库(Database),是指按照一定的数据模型组织、存储和管理数据的集合。数据库管理系统(Database Management System,简称DBMS)是用于管理数据库的软件系统。

    DB数据库主要用于存储和管理大量数据,可以提供高效的数据存储、查询、更新和删除等操作。常见的DB数据库有关系型数据库(如MySQL、Oracle、SQL Server)、非关系型数据库(如MongoDB、Redis、Elasticsearch)等。

    下面将从方法、操作流程等方面讲解DB数据库。

    一、数据库的创建

    1. 选择合适的数据库管理系统(DBMS),如MySQL、Oracle等。
    2. 安装数据库管理系统,根据安装向导进行操作。
    3. 打开数据库管理系统的客户端工具,如MySQL Workbench、Oracle SQL Developer等。
    4. 连接数据库管理系统,输入正确的主机地址、端口号、用户名和密码。
    5. 创建新的数据库,可以通过命令行或客户端工具的图形界面进行操作。
    6. 指定数据库的名称和字符集,设置其他参数(如存储引擎、排序规则等)。
    7. 点击确认或执行相应的命令,等待数据库创建完成。

    二、数据库表的设计

    1. 根据需求分析和数据模型设计,确定数据库表的结构。
    2. 打开数据库管理系统的客户端工具,连接到已创建的数据库。
    3. 创建新的表,可以通过命令行或客户端工具的图形界面进行操作。
    4. 指定表的名称和字段,设置字段的数据类型、长度、约束等。
    5. 设计表的主键、外键和索引,提高数据的查询效率。
    6. 点击确认或执行相应的命令,等待表创建完成。

    三、数据库的操作

    1. 插入数据:使用INSERT语句将数据插入到表中。
    2. 查询数据:使用SELECT语句从表中查询数据。
    3. 更新数据:使用UPDATE语句更新表中的数据。
    4. 删除数据:使用DELETE语句从表中删除数据。
    5. 创建视图:使用CREATE VIEW语句创建视图,可以简化数据查询操作。
    6. 创建存储过程:使用CREATE PROCEDURE语句创建存储过程,可以实现复杂的数据处理逻辑。
    7. 创建触发器:使用CREATE TRIGGER语句创建触发器,可以在表上定义自动执行的操作。

    四、数据库的备份与恢复

    1. 数据库备份:使用备份工具或命令对数据库进行备份,生成备份文件。
    2. 数据库恢复:使用恢复工具或命令将备份文件恢复到数据库中。
    3. 定期备份:根据需求设定备份策略,定期对数据库进行备份,保证数据的安全性。

    五、数据库的优化和性能调优

    1. 优化查询语句:对查询语句进行优化,提高查询效率。
    2. 创建索引:根据查询需求创建合适的索引,加快数据的检索速度。
    3. 调整数据库参数:根据系统资源和负载情况,调整数据库的参数设置,提高系统性能。
    4. 分区表:将大表分成多个分区,提高数据的存储和查询效率。
    5. 数据库缓存:使用缓存技术减少对数据库的访问次数,提高系统性能。

    总结:以上是关于DB数据库的一些方法、操作流程等方面的讲解。通过数据库的创建、表的设计、操作、备份与恢复以及优化和性能调优等步骤,可以有效地管理和利用大量的数据。对于开发人员和数据分析师来说,掌握DB数据库的基本操作是非常重要的。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部